    The Role 

    The Senior Manager, Workforce Strategy plays a meaningful role in enabling enterprise workforce decisions through data-driven insights, analytics, forecasting, and strategic workforce planning. Reporting to the VP, Workforce Strategy and Markets Governance, this role partners across the business, HR, Finance, and Strategy teams to deliver actionable workforce intelligence that informs talent investments, organizational priorities, and long-term workforce strategies. This role combines strong analytical capabilities, business acumen, and stakeholder engagement skills to drive enterprise workforce outcomes and support a culture of evidence-based decision-making.

    The Team 

    This dynamic team is part of the Enterprise HR function within Corporate Services and is responsible for developing and driving forward a strategic, forward-thinking approach to reshape our workforce strategy as we look toward the future. The team partners with a wide range of stakeholders spanning executive leadership and business and technology leaders across the firm. 

    Fidelity’s Onsite Working Model
    Fidelity is transitioning to a full-time onsite working model through a phased rollout across regions and roles. Currently, some roles and locations require 100% onsite presence, while others require less. Onsite expectations are likely to evolve as the rollout continues. This transition does not apply to fully remote roles.
